CIT Aerospace to order 50 Airbus Aircraft

Toulouse, le 24  juillet  2000

CIT Aerospace, an operating unit of the CIT Group, a leading United States based financial services corporation, has executed a firm letter of intent for the purchase of 35 Airbus single-aisle aircraft, as well as 15 Airbus A330s. This major repeat order, coming only two years after CIT first became an Airbus customer, includes all members of Airbus' A320 Family, including the 107-seat A31 8, and also reflects CIT's decision to become a launch customer for Airbus' newly planned A330-500 aircraft, which remains subject to launch. The order provides for significant flexibility within the A330/A340 Family of aircraft and will be converted to other members of the family in the event that the A330-500 is not launched. With this order, CIT wilt now be able to offer airlines around the world a broad choice of Airbus aircraft, ranging from the smallest A318 to the A330-300 widebody twin and potentially the ultra-long range four-engine A340. CIT's Nikita Zdanow, a Group Chief Executive Officer, said that this significant investment decision was based on CIT's strong growth outlook In the aviation field and its success with the financial performance of the Airbus portfolio. C. Jeffrey Knittel, President of CIT Aerospace added, "We are a strong believer in the market's need for new aircraft in the 200 to 276 seat segment. The A330-500, with its unique payload and range capability, its economic characteristics, as well as its commonality with both the smaller A320 Family and larger Airbus A330/A340 Family aircraft, truly opens new potential for any type of airline in this segment." Noel Forgeard, Airbus's Chief Executive Officer, expressed his gratitude to CIT and said, "Although our relationship with CIT is relatively young, it has become a very strong and promising one. We are impressed with CIT as a major distributor of our aircraft and are gratified by the vote of confidence of this renowned financial institution. CIT's endorsement of the A330-500 project is a very valuable step in the development of this new programme and underscores again that, besides being outstanding, Airbus aircraft also represent very attractive financial investments." CIT already has 25 Airbus single-aisles and five A330 twin-aisles on order. This early repeatorder for Airbus' best-selling A320 Family and market-leading A330/A340 Family, would bring the total number of Airbus aircraft ordered by CIT to 80 units in just over two years.
